Limitations and Careful Considerations
While versatile, this asset is not a universal fix. I advise caution when using it in dense information layouts. If your digital ads are text-heavy, adding a detailed reindeer can create visual clutter, reducing readability. Similarly, on small mobile screens, intricate details of the "glow" effect might get lost if the file size is not optimized or if the contrast is too low.
Furthermore, avoid using this asset for formal corporate branding. The whimsical nature clashes with serious financial or legal messaging. It also struggles on low-contrast backgrounds; if your brand uses dark modes, ensure you adjust the SVG fill to maintain visibility. Always test how it pairs with your chosen typography. I found it harmonized well with serif and handwritten fonts but looked awkward next to rigid, industrial sans-serif typefaces.
Practical Designer Notes for Implementation
Before deploying the Holiday Cheer Glow Reindeer SVG in a paid campaign, follow these practical steps to ensure commercial design standards are met:
- Check Licensing: Even though it is listed under Freebies, always verify the commercial license terms. Ensure it covers client work and paid advertising if you are an agency.
- Color Testing: Do not rely on the default colors. Test the SVG against your primary, secondary, and accent brand colors. Ensure it maintains integrity in black and white for cost-effective printing.
- Mockup Integration: Place the asset inside real campaign mockups. View it on mobile, tablet, and desktop simulations to check for balance and spacing issues.
- Competitor Analysis: Compare your final design against competitor visuals. If everyone is using similar reindeer clipart, consider rotating or flipping the SVG to create a unique composition.
- Font Pairing: Experiment with different font styles. A delicate script font often complements the organic lines of the reindeer, enhancing the overall modern design feel.
